I rented a car in Sicily with Differental through Discovercars.com in June 2024.
When I arrived at the pick up desk, Differental asked me to buy the insurance (which was more expensive that what I paid for the rental). Since I was already covered with Discvercars.com I refused.
I took the car for 4 days, only used it to go from the airport to my hotel. When I brought it back, I was in a hurry and did not have time to check the car (my bad).
Later they sent me random pictures of little scratches that were already there and even of some that I already flagged the first they. Nothing was written on the paper explaining the damages. They invoiced me 500 EUR for each part of the car = 2'000 EUR! They are thiefs do not trust them.
Fortunately discovercars fully reimbursed me the amounts.

Scam
We had a lovely holiday to Lake Garda in September but just wanted to advise anyone thinking of hiring a car to avoid Differental care hire from Milan Bergamo airport.
I paid €379 euros for 2 weeks €140 of which was for 2 car seats to fit a 1 year old and 3 year old. We had to get a 20minute shuttle to collect the car so we were in the middle of nowhere. On arrival there was another customer who was distressed that they didn’t have a car seat available for her young baby. In the end she had to leave without the car seat.
We were then issued our car seats which were the complete wrong size for our children. They were trying to put my 1 year old on a booster seat 🤦♀️. On complaining they tried to say this was fine. They eventually agreed to go and buy the correct car seats, telling us we’d have to wait at the office for an hour. We agreed to this as we didn’t really have much choice.
In the end we waited for 3 hours in a tiny office with some very restless kids. They returned with a car seat clearly from their mates car, covered in crisps. They couldn’t fit it in the car right so it was precariously strapped in with the seat belt and wobbled severely. It was a disaster but with hungry kids and no other way to get to the site we felt we had no real choice but to accept this.
The actual car was fine although not the one I booked. We hit the motorway and were driving in torrential rain, it was pretty stressful driving for the first time in Italy let alone in such poor visibility with car seats that are obviously unsafe. Then a warning light flashed up on the dashboard with a KM countdown. The warning was in Italian and after googling it was telling us to urgently top up the AdBlue and if we turned off the engine it would not restart. We didn’t know if the engine would suddenly stop on the motorway (we don’t have a car that needs AdBlue so no idea about how that works).
We called the hire company and they were useless telling us to get AdBlue immediately and that they would reimburse us. We stopped at 4 service stations but they were unmanned. In the end we just drove to Bella Italia and on stopping the car it wouldn’t restart.
We had to waste the first day of the holiday finding AdBlue and sorting that out and luckily the car did restart (I’m told some cars would still not have restarted at this point).
We returned the car in exactly the same condition we was given to us but a day after we got an email saying we were being charged £500 for a scratch. The photos don’t even show any scratch. We have photos take before and after the hire period that are identical. We disputed the scratch and Differental just said they were going to charge the credit card. We then tried to claim for this amount through the car hire excess insurance we took out and they cannot pay out until they have received an invoice/damage matrix from Differental but they are no longer responding to emails and the insurance won’t pay out until they have this.
